<p>For many reasons conferences in general are becoming increasingly unpopular.  Some of the reasons <a href="http://thedigitalsanctuary.org/2009/01/30/face-to-face-at-innovation3-gathering/">conferences are loosing their momentum</a> have been discussed previously here.  Most conferences are organized around the old broadcast model of communication.  A single (often dynamic) speaker talking to a large group of passive listeners would be typical, then breakouts based on this same model would follow.</p>
<p>But there are a good handful of new conference models springing up.  For example, I&#8217;ve gotten to participate in the two <a href="http://thedigitalsanctuary.org/2008/09/26/church-techcamp-debut-los-angeles/">Church Tech Camps</a> (Pasadena &amp; Dallas) which were structured more like conversations with up front moderators but lots of interactive dialog and breakouts that allowed for many individuals to share ideas and insights.</p>
<p><a href="http://theideacamp.ning.com/">The Idea Camp</a> is similarly structured.   Philosophically open source, <a href="http://theideacamp.ning.com/">The Idea Camp</a> purposefully juxtaposes ideologies, personalities and ministry styles for a diversity of dialog rather than a lecture-based structure.  I, myself, am looking forward to hearing from those I don&#8217;t necessarily agree with.</p>
<p>Additionally, there&#8217;s a sweeping list of moderators, many of whom use a-typical or pioneer approaches to their ministry endeavors creating a unique setting for both inspiration and the exploration of practical ministry tools.  In fact, although everything is set up open discussion style, the goal is not just talk.  Ideas to implementation would best describe the point of the gathering.</p>
